Retired agent Kathy Lambert is interviewed about supervising the Joint Terrorism Task Force (JTTF) in Philadelphia and South Jersey and working on several high-profile cases, including the investigation and prosecution of the infamous homegrown terrorists known as Jihad Jane. Kathy reviews the Jihad Jane case, her TDY assignments around the world, and the importance of local, state, and federal law enforcement partners working together to combat the threat of terrorism in the United States. Prior to joining the Bureau, Kathy had earned a Ph.D. in Political Science with a concentration in Counterterrorism.
